A siding extended for a few hundred yards south of Norwich City station, leaving the station on its east side and crossing Station Road before running alongside the River Wensum to end at New Mills Yard.  There a very short jetty extended into the river at its highest navigable point.  Although the jetty has long gone, two sets of rails went onto the jetty and the remains of both pairs can still be seen in May 2018. Anecdotal information suggests that, amongst other cargoes, locomotive ash from the engine shed was sent by river for disposal.
